I am trying to set up a tanker in such a way that it will react to flights as they approach. I was thinking of trying to use the "change to way point" option and work from there. I have a moving trigger set on the tanker and when the flight is close enough the tanker will turn and role out in front of the flight. This works with the exception that the tanker will begin to make the left turn but just before the 90 deg point reverses and comes all the way around to the right!

I tried it every which way, even used different AC, different altitudes and such.

 

So any idea what may be going on here???

Posted

What they're doing is turning left then coming back right so they wind up on the flight path line from A->B, as opposed to being slightly offset as they would be with a single turn. This behavior cannot be avoided, you'll just have to wait for the AI to settle down. Maybe this sweet MS paint illustration will be more clear.
